diff options
author | Andrei Karas <akaras@inbox.ru> | 2013-03-27 21:45:16 +0300 |
---|---|---|
committer | Andrei Karas <akaras@inbox.ru> | 2013-03-27 21:45:16 +0300 |
commit | 0fe0f8bae7b754453e6e6bb7c7b29903facb9311 (patch) | |
tree | d92c810fbc93fe8bb2f362a7ef023ebe96653c2d /src/commands.cpp | |
parent | 8150191686759b13a239c25970924c3c186140ff (diff) | |
download | plus-0fe0f8bae7b754453e6e6bb7c7b29903facb9311.tar.gz plus-0fe0f8bae7b754453e6e6bb7c7b29903facb9311.tar.bz2 plus-0fe0f8bae7b754453e6e6bb7c7b29903facb9311.tar.xz plus-0fe0f8bae7b754453e6e6bb7c7b29903facb9311.zip |
improve chathandler class.
Diffstat (limited to 'src/commands.cpp')
-rw-r--r-- | src/commands.cpp | 21 |
1 files changed, 2 insertions, 19 deletions
diff --git a/src/commands.cpp b/src/commands.cpp index 80e276d8b..1beba22d5 100644 --- a/src/commands.cpp +++ b/src/commands.cpp @@ -88,7 +88,7 @@ static void outString(ChatTab *const tab, const std::string &str, { if (!tab) { - Net::getChatHandler()->me(def); + Net::getChatHandler()->me(def, GENERAL_CHANNEL); return; } @@ -114,7 +114,7 @@ static void outString(ChatTab *const tab, const std::string &str, break; } default: - Net::getChatHandler()->me(def); + Net::getChatHandler()->me(def, GENERAL_CHANNEL); break; } } @@ -362,23 +362,6 @@ impHandler0(cleanFonts) debugChatTab->chatLog(_("Cache cleaned")); } -impHandler(join) -{ - if (!tab) - return; - - const size_t pos = args.find(' '); - const std::string name(args, 0, pos); - const std::string password(args, pos + 1); - tab->chatLog(strprintf(_("Requesting to join channel %s."), name.c_str())); - Net::getChatHandler()->enterChannel(name, password); -} - -impHandler0(listChannels) -{ - Net::getChatHandler()->channelList(); -} - impHandler(createParty) { if (!tab) |